Installation

Claude Code / Cursor / Codex

$curl -o ~/.claude/skills/documentation/SKILL.md --create-dirs "https://raw.githubusercontent.com/christophacham/agent-skills-library/main/skills/writing/documentation/SKILL.md"

Manual Installation

  1. Download SKILL.md from GitHub
  2. Place it in .claude/skills/documentation/SKILL.md inside your project
  3. Restart your AI agent — it will auto-discover the skill

## Documentation Types

### Code-Level
- JSDoc/TSDoc comments
- Function documentation
- Type definitions
- Example code

### API Documentation
- Endpoint reference
- Request/response schemas
- Authentication guides
- SDK documentation

### Architecture Documentation
- System overview
- Component diagrams
- Data flow diagrams
- Deployment architecture

### User Documentation
- Getting started guides
- User manuals
- Tutorials
- FAQs

### Process Documentation
- Runbooks
- Onboarding guides
- SOPs
- Decision records

## Quality Gates

- [ ] All APIs documented
- [ ] Architecture diagrams current
- [ ] README up to date
- [ ] Code comments helpful
- [ ] Examples working
- [ ] Links valid
